ADHD Medications

Methylphenidate is also known as Ritalin is a stimulant drug that increases brain activity in regions of the brain responsible for controlling attention and behavior. It is the most common ADHD medication prescribed in Europe and the UK. It can be taken as immediate-release tablets or modified release once daily tablets.

Psychiatrists with a specialization in ADHD have a deep understanding of the medications that are available to treat this condition. Adults with ADHD are usually treated first with medication but therapy with a therapist is also suggested.

Stimulants

Stimulants are by far the most popular kind of medication for adhd in the UK and help by increasing the amount of neurotransmitters (the chemicals that help brain cells communicate) in synapses. This improves attention, and decreases impulsivity and hyperactivity. They start working within 45-60 minutes. The stimulants include drugs such as amphetamines, such as Adderall, Dexedrine and Concerta and methylphenidate such as Ritalin and Concerta.

Your doctor will be able to adjust the dose to ensure you get the perfect balance of effects, whether you are taking stimulants or non-stimulants. Your doctor will look at your feelings as well as the most common adverse reactions and whether or not the drug is effective. They usually review the prescription on a regular schedule.

Many adults have reported that they had to limit their prescriptions or even store them to last until the shortage is solved.

The short-term supply issue is caused by a number of reasons, including delays in production and issues with limits. This isn't a sole issue in the UK, as there have been shortages in the US too.

In the longer term the government has committed to cooperate with manufacturers to ensure the continuity of supply for ADHD medications and is expected to solve the problem by October at most. The NHS recommends that people consult their doctor prior to running out of their medication and to only change dosage or frequency after consulting their doctor. They can also assist with the arrangement of alternative treatments to keep you feeling well and focused. They could, for instance, recommend cognitive behavioral therapy or mindfullness. They can also suggest strategies to improve sleep or reduce stress. This multimodal approach has been proven to be the most effective treatment for ADHD. The most effective approaches combine medication with lifestyle changes and behavioral therapy. Evidence-based practice is what we call this.
